Wedding Piano at Armathwaite Hall
At Armathwaite Hall, guests usually first arrive into the Main Hall. It’s a large space with high ceilings and wood panelling, so one of Craig’s portable baby grand pianos feels completely at home here, both visually and musically, as people gather. The height of the room lends itself well to more ambient music, so many couples opt for lighter, more atmospheric choices during this part of the day.
Ceremonies are usually held in the Lake View Lounge, where the venue’s own electric baby grand piano is one of the first things guests see as they take their seats. Guests file out past the piano at the end of the ceremony too, so that’s a great opportunity to choose a favourite song that sets the mood you’d like for the rest of the day.
Couples and their guests love to head outside onto the terrace and lawns overlooking Bassenthwaite following the ceremony, and it’s a real sun trap on a bright day. Live piano works especially well for relaxed drinks receptions in the fresh Lakeland air. You can enjoy a video of some alfresco drinks entertainment below, where the couple asked for a selection of 90s classics — you’ll be able to tailor the music to reflect you as a couple too.
For the wedding breakfast, the piano can be set up in whichever room is being used. In the larger Broadwater and Lime Trees suites, the music carries easily without being intrusive from anywhere in the spaces, and in the smaller Dining Room the piano is usually positioned off to the side near the conservatory doors, with a more intimate approach taken to the music and guests welcome to make requests.
